Java Update on Windows 10:全面指南
简介
在Windows 10操作系统上更新Java是确保Java应用程序和开发环境正常运行且安全的重要操作。随着Java技术的不断发展,更新可以修复安全漏洞、提高性能并引入新功能。本文将详细介绍在Windows 10上进行Java更新的相关知识,包括基础概念、使用方法、常见实践以及最佳实践,帮助读者更好地管理Java环境。
目录
- Java Update基础概念
- 在Windows 10上更新Java的方法
- 手动更新
- 自动更新
- 常见实践
- 更新后检查Java版本
- 解决更新过程中的问题
- 最佳实践
- 定期更新计划
- 备份与回滚策略
- 小结
- 参考资料
Java Update基础概念
Java Update即Java的更新操作。Java由Oracle公司开发和维护,更新包含多种类型: - 安全更新:修复已知的安全漏洞,防止恶意软件攻击和数据泄露。例如,一些旧版本的Java可能存在远程代码执行漏洞,更新可以有效封堵这些安全风险。 - 功能更新:引入新的API、增强现有功能等。例如,新的Java版本可能支持更高效的并发处理机制,提升应用程序性能。 - 性能更新:优化Java虚拟机(JVM)的性能,提高应用程序的运行速度和资源利用率。
在Windows 10上更新Java的方法
手动更新
- 下载最新Java安装包
- 访问Oracle官方网站的Java下载页面(https://www.oracle.com/java/technologies/javase-downloads.html)。
- 根据你的Windows 10系统版本(32位或64位)选择对应的Java安装包进行下载。
- 安装更新
- 找到下载的安装包文件,双击运行它。
- 在安装向导中,按照提示逐步操作。可能需要接受许可协议、选择安装路径等。默认情况下,安装程序会自动检测并覆盖旧版本的Java。
自动更新
- 启用Java自动更新
- 打开“控制面板”,找到“Java”图标并双击打开Java控制面板。
- 在Java控制面板中,切换到“更新”选项卡。
- 勾选“自动检查更新”选项,并根据需要选择是否自动安装更新。如果选择自动安装,Java会在有可用更新时自动下载并安装,无需用户手动干预。
常见实践
更新后检查Java版本
更新完成后,需要确认Java版本是否已成功更新。可以通过命令行进行检查:
1. 打开命令提示符(CMD)。
2. 在命令提示符中输入命令:java -version
3. 系统将显示当前安装的Java版本信息。例如:
java version "11.0.11" 2022-04-19 LTS
Java(TM) SE Runtime Environment 11.0.11 (build 11.0.11+9-LTS-194)
Java HotSpot(TM) 64-Bit Server VM 11.0.11 (build 11.0.11+9-LTS-194, mixed mode)
解决更新过程中的问题
- 网络问题:如果在下载更新时遇到网络连接中断或下载速度过慢的问题,可以尝试更换网络环境,或者使用下载工具(如IDM)进行下载。
- 安装错误:若安装过程中出现错误提示,如权限不足等,以管理员身份运行安装程序。在安装包文件上右键单击,选择“以管理员身份运行”。
最佳实践
定期更新计划
为了确保系统的安全性和性能,建议制定定期更新Java的计划。例如,可以每月或每季度检查一次Java是否有可用更新,并及时进行更新。可以使用日历应用或任务调度工具来提醒自己进行更新操作。
备份与回滚策略
在进行Java更新之前,建议备份重要的Java项目和配置文件。虽然更新通常是安全的,但万一出现问题,可以回滚到旧版本。备份的方法可以是复制项目文件夹到其他位置,或者使用版本控制系统(如Git)进行备份。 如果更新后出现兼容性问题或其他严重问题,可以通过卸载新安装的Java版本,重新安装旧版本来实现回滚。在“控制面板”的“程序和功能”中找到Java相关条目,选择卸载即可。
小结
在Windows 10上更新Java是维护Java环境健康运行的必要操作。通过了解基础概念,掌握手动和自动更新方法,以及遵循常见实践和最佳实践,读者可以轻松管理Java更新,确保Java应用程序的安全、稳定和高效运行。